Revised draft GST Law

Revised draft GST Law was put on the public domain on 25th November 2016 and thereafter, whatever suggestions have been received by GST Council were reviewed during GST Council Meetings held during the month December 2016 and finally all the sections of CGST Law
& SGST Law have been approved. Similarly, all provisions of IGST Law except for dual control has been approved by GST Council. However, issue of control on the Assessment Adjudications & Audits of the Dealers having turnover less than Rs. 1.5 Cr. has not been finalized since Law Ministry have opined differentlythan that of demands of State Govt. Perhaps, this issue will be settled in the month January 2017 but winter session of the Parliament has been washed out because political differences on demonetisation and therefore CGST Law & IGST Law could not be tabled in the parliament. Now, it may be tabled in the month of Feb 2017 i.e. Budget Session, but prior to February 2017, issues need to be resolved and therefore meeting the deadlines of Rollout of GST from 1st April 2017 seems to ambitious and difficult.
